想学cnc编程要先学什么呢

fiy 其他 6

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习CNC编程前,你需要先掌握以下几个基础知识:

    1. 机械基础知识:了解机械零件的组成和工作原理,掌握常见机械加工工艺和工具的使用方法。这可以帮助你更好地理解CNC编程中的工艺要求和加工过程。

    2. 数学知识:CNC编程涉及到许多数学计算,如坐标转换、插补算法等。掌握基础的数学知识,如代数、几何、三角学等,对于理解和应用CNC编程非常重要。

    3. 编程基础:学习CNC编程需要具备一定的编程基础。你可以选择学习一门编程语言,如C、C++、Python等,以便更好地理解和编写CNC程序。

    4. CAD/CAM软件:CAD(计算机辅助设计)和CAM(计算机辅助制造)软件是CNC编程的重要工具。你需要学习使用这些软件进行零件的设计和加工路径的生成。

    5. 蓝图阅读:学习如何读懂和解释机械零件的蓝图是CNC编程的基本技能。你需要了解蓝图上的尺寸、符号、公差等信息,以便正确编写CNC程序。

    除了上述基础知识,还需要进行实践操作。你可以通过参加培训课程、在线教育平台或自学教材等途径学习CNC编程。通过实际操作和不断练习,你可以逐步提高自己的编程技能,并在实际工作中应用CNC编程技术。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要学习CNC编程,首先需要掌握以下几个方面的知识:

    1. 机械基础知识:了解基本的机械结构、工作原理和运动学原理,包括机床结构、刀具的选择和使用、切削力的计算等。

    2. 数控技术基础:了解数控技术的基本原理和发展历程,包括数控机床的分类、坐标系、插补原理、数控程序的格式等。

    3. 编程语言:学习掌握CNC编程所使用的编程语言,例如G代码和M代码。G代码用于控制机床的运动,M代码用于控制机床的辅助功能。

    4. 数学知识:掌握一定的数学知识,包括几何知识、三角函数、向量运算等,以便能够进行坐标变换、插补计算等。

    5. 实践经验:通过实践操作和实际项目的编程练习,不断积累经验和提升技能。可以通过参加培训课程、实习或实际工作等方式来获取实践经验。

    总的来说,学习CNC编程需要掌握机械基础知识、数控技术基础、编程语言、数学知识以及实践经验。这些知识和技能的掌握将帮助你理解和应用CNC编程,进而能够独立进行CNC编程工作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要学习CNC编程,首先需要掌握一些基本的知识和技能。以下是学习CNC编程的几个关键步骤。

    1. 学习机械基础知识
      在学习CNC编程之前,建议先了解一些机械基础知识。这包括机械工艺、机械加工原理、切削工具和刀具材料等。这些知识将帮助你更好地理解和应用CNC编程。

    2. 学习机床操作
      CNC编程是基于机床操作的,因此学习机床操作是非常重要的。你需要了解机床的结构、工作原理和操作流程。掌握机床的操作将帮助你更好地理解和运用CNC编程。

    3. 学习G代码和M代码
      G代码和M代码是CNC编程的核心。G代码用于控制机床的运动轨迹,M代码用于控制机床的辅助功能。你需要学习不同的G代码和M代码的含义和用法,以及它们的语法规则。

    4. 学习CNC编程软件
      CNC编程软件是用于编写和编辑CNC程序的工具。常用的CNC编程软件包括Mastercam、PowerMill、GibbsCAM等。你需要学习如何使用这些软件进行CNC编程,包括创建工件模型、定义切削路径、生成G代码等。

    5. 实践和练习
      学习CNC编程最重要的是实践和练习。你可以通过模拟仿真软件或在实际机床上进行实际操作来练习CNC编程。通过实践和练习,你将更加熟悉CNC编程的流程和技巧,提高自己的编程能力。

    总之,学习CNC编程需要掌握机械基础知识、学习机床操作、掌握G代码和M代码、学习CNC编程软件,并进行实践和练习。通过不断学习和实践,你将逐渐掌握CNC编程技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部